From d0fc1768eeef7a5c46b627530508272933550adc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Matthew Oliver Date: Thu, 29 Aug 2019 09:31:22 +1000 Subject: [PATCH] Add CVE-2019-5477 the to travis ignore list (SOC-9635) A bunch of PRs in the crowbar-core are blocked due to a travis CI check: bundle-audit check --ignore ... This is due to a security embargo that was lifted and blocked by a version of nokogiri: Name: nokogiri Version: 1.9.1 Advisory: CVE-2019-5477 Criticality: Unknown URL: https://github.com/sparklemotion/nokogiri/issues/1915 Title: Nokogiri Command Injection Vulnerability via Nokogiri::CSS::Tokenizer#load_file Solution: upgrade to >= 1.10.4 I asked about it in the rocketchat #cloud channel, and apparently Rick has looked into it and it seems we are unaffected by it as we don't use the version when building the RPM. I've also done a quick look through IBS and I can't see nokogiri as a build requirement for crowbar, crowbar-core or crowbar-openstack. Well it isn't even mentioned in any of the spec files. So raising this PR to add it to the ignore so we can unblock the crowbar-core PRs. Adding the SOC-9635, as its the patch of mine that is blocked on it, and so it passes travis CI.
